Self-assembling, patterning and SPR imaging of a 1,3 alternate bis(dipyridyl)calix[4]arene derivative-Cu2+ complex immobilized on to Au(111) surfaces

Zito V
2004

Abstract

The electrochemically switchable Cu2+ complex of a 1,3 alternate bis(dipyridyl)calix[4]arene derivative forms self-assembled monolayers on Au(111) surfaces. The receptor is patterned on the surface by using microcontact printing procedures and the resulting surface is imaged via SPR.
